As per the current implementation, for WLED5, after the FSC (Full Scale Current) update the driver is incorrectly toggling the MOD_SYNC register instead of toggling the SYNC register. The patch 1/2 fixes this by toggling the SYNC register after FSC update. 2. Currently, the sync bits are set-then-cleared after FSC and brightness update. As per hardware team recommendation the FSC and brightness sync takes place from clear-then-set transition of the sync bits. The patch 2/2 fies this issue. Changes from V3: 1.
